Assistant Manager Operations Manager information

How much is the salary of an assistant manager operations manager?

The salary of an assistant manager operations manager typically ranges from $50,000 to $80,000 annually, depending on experience, industry, and location. They often receive additional benefits such as bonuses, health insurance, and opportunities for advancement.

Is an assistant manager operations manager a high paying job?

An assistant manager operations manager role typically offers a moderate to high salary depending on the industry, location, and level of experience. These positions often include responsibilities such as team supervision, process management, and operational planning, which can influence compensation levels. Overall, it is considered a mid- to upper-tier management position with competitive pay in many sectors.

Is operations manager higher than assistant manager?

An operations manager is typically a higher-level role than an assistant manager, overseeing broader functions and multiple teams within an organization. Assistant managers usually support managers and handle specific tasks or departments, reporting to the operations or general manager. The hierarchy can vary by company, but generally, the operations manager has more responsibility and authority.

What does an assistant manager operations manager do?

An assistant manager operations manager oversees daily business activities, manages staff, ensures operational efficiency, and implements company policies. They often coordinate between departments, handle customer issues, and support the manager in achieving organizational goals, requiring strong leadership and organizational skills.
